    Safety Instructions to Follow While Using Power Tools

    Power tools are not just equipment for professionals. Tools like the Makita tools have become an integral part of a homeowner’s life. They have become so typical in our life that we often overlook the safety hazards they pose. If one fails to use them properly or maintain them, these tools are capable of causing severe injuries.

    Most of these issues result from the misuse of power tools. Regardless of whether it is from the development of unsafe habits or lack of proper training, these problems need to be addressed. Here are three main causes behind power tool injuries:

    1. Complacency or Inattention

    If you are in a hurry to beat your deadline, you increase the risk of injuries and accidents. It doesn’t matter how confident and competent you are; you should not allow yourself to become complacent or inattentive.

    2. Unexpected Accidents

    Power tools usually operate at very high speeds. This means that when something happens, it happens quickly. If you are inexperienced, unaware of how the tool works, or plan poorly, the chances are that thing might end badly even worse.

    3. Overconfidence or Inexperience

    Accidents involving novices are often caused by a lack of respect for the tools’ capabilities or necessary knowledge of safety issues. If you are an inexperienced operator, you might not be able to identify a dangerous situation. Meanwhile, with experience, you might become overconfident in your abilities.

    That is why you must wear the proper personal protective equipment like gloves and safety glasses at all times. These will protect you from the hazards you might encounter while working with power tools. Also, you should keep the floor of your workplace as dry and clean as possible. This will prevent any accidental slips around or on dangerous power tools. Make sure that all your tools are fitted with safety switches and guards. When used improperly, these tools can be extremely hazardous. Here are some more precautions that you need to take while using a power tool:

    • Do not carry around a power tool by its hose or cord.
    • Do not yank the hose or cord for disconnecting it from the power source.
    • Keep the hoses and cords away from sharp edges, oil, and heat.
    • When you are not using the tools, disconnect them. This includes: while cleaning and servicing them and changing the accessories like cutters, blades, and bits.
    • All the people that are involved in the project should be kept at a safe distance from the workspace at all times.
    • Secure your work with a vice or clamps so that both hands are free for operating the power tool.
    • Avoid starting the tools accidentally. While you are carrying the plugged-in power tool, do not put your fingers on the trigger or switch button.
    • Exercise carefulness while maintaining the tools. For best performance, keep them clean and sharp.
    • Read the instructions provided in the user manual carefully and change and lubricate accessories accordingly.
    • Maintain proper balance and keep good footing while operating your power tools.
    • While using the tools, wear proper apparel. Loose clothing, jewellery or ties might get caught in between the moving parts.
    • Get rid of damaged electric tools.
    • Make sure that all the power tools are kept in good condition and regularly inspected for defects.

    There is a wide range of power tools available in the market today, such as the Makita tools that help people perform more tasks and be more efficient than ever before. However, if you misuse them, they can lead to severe injury and even death.
